Training of Parents. By Ernest Hamlin Abbott. Boston: Houghton, Mifflin & Co., 1908. Pp. 140. It is a thankless task not unaccompanied by danger to animadvert on the subject of parents. The reader is in all likelihood an actual, prospective, or would-be parent himself, with the pride and acute sensitiveness of that large class. Mr. Abbott in his book "On the Training of Parents," treats the subject with humor and tact and on the whole lets the parent down
